La première partie traite du développement historique de la criminologie. Partant des réflexions philosophiques et politiques qui ont préparé le terrain à l’arrivée du droit pénal au XVIIIe siècle, particulièrement en ce qui a trait aux premières théories de la peine qui en ont articulé une logique punitive, l’auteur présente son développement au XIXe siècle et la rupture des années 1960-1970 où de nombreux chercheurs tentent de sortir de cette logique. La deuxième partie est centrée sur la situation canadienne, explorant les différentes facettes du système pénal. Les caractéristiques du droit et de la procédure pénale, la spécificité des femmes et des Autochtones, ainsi que le rôle de la police en tant qu’acteur au point d’entrée de ce système de justice sont abordés. Le passage devant les tribunaux et la détermination de la peine, l’aide aux justiciables, et particulièrement aux personnes aux prises avec des problématiques de santé mentale, font partie de cette section. En dernière partie, elle s’intéresse aux problématiques contemporaines et la mondialisation des échanges qui ont contribué à l’expansion des objets en criminologie. Elle aborde les mécanismes de surveillance, les banques de données, l’arrivée du secteur privé dans le contrôle des espaces publics, et surtout la redéfinition politique de ce qui constitue l’objet de la surveillance à travers les politiques sécuritaires. Elle conclut avec des réflexions sur la torture, la violence politique et les conflits armés.

Cet ouvrage souligne le 40e anniversaire du Département de criminologie de l’Université d’Ottawa, fondé en 1968. On y relate l’histoire du département de ses origines à nos jours en mettant l’accent sur les débats théoriques qui ont influencé son approche critique et autoréflexive de la criminologie. Les articles qui le composent s’inscrivent dans cet ordre d’idée en mettant en question la perspective traditionnelle de la criminologie sur divers sujets, notamment les études policières, la santé mentale, la violence politique, le suicide et la prévention du crime. Droits et voix souligne le rôle primordial que joue l’Université d’Ottawa dans la redéfinition de la criminologie et la promotion du militantisme, de la justice sociale et de la compassion. -- This volume commemorates the 40th anniversary of the University of Ottawa’s Department of Criminology, founded in 1968. It relates the history of the department from its origins to today, focusing on the theoretical debates that have influenced its critical and self reflexive approach to criminology. The contributions to this volume continue in that vein by questioning the traditional perspective of criminology on a variety of topics including police studies, mental health, political violence, suicide, and crime prevention. Rights and Voices reveals the significant role that the University of Ottawa has played in redefining criminology to advocate activism, social justice, and compassion.

Contemporary Criminological Issues tackles some of today’s most pressing social issues, from the criminalization of Indigenous peoples to interpersonal violence, border control, and armed conflicts. This book advances cutting-edge theories and methods, with the aim of moving beyond the scholarship that reproduces insecurity and exclusion. The breadth of approaches encompasses much of the current critical criminological scholarship, serving as a counterpoint to the growth of managerial and administrative criminologies and the rise of explicitly exclusionary and punitive state policies and practices with respect to ‘crime’ and ‘security.’ This edited collection featuring two books, one in English and one in French, includes important contributions to knowledge and public policy by eminent experts and emerging scholars. Crimes Against Nature provides a systematic account and analysis of the key concerns of green criminology, written by one of the leading authorities in the field. The book draws upon the disciplines of environmental studies, environmental sociology and environmental management as well as criminology and socio-legal studies, and draws upon a wide range of examples of crimes against the environment – ranging from toxic waste, logging, wildlife smuggling, bio-piracy, the use and transport of ozone depleting substances through to illegal logging and fishing, water pollution and animal abuse. The book is divided into three parts: Part 1 sets out theoretical approaches and perspectives on the subject; Part 2 explores the (national and international) dimensions of environmental crime and the explanations for it; Part 3 deals with the range of responses to environmental crime - environmental law enforcement, regulation, environmental crime prevention and the role of global institutions and movements.
